36-8-12-10. Volunteers; medical treatment and burial expense coverage; determinations; premium expenses

IN Code § 36-8-12-10 (2019) (N/A)
Copy with citation
Copy as parenthetical citation

Sec. 10. (a) A:

(1) volunteer firefighter, a member of the emergency medical services personnel, or an emergency medical technician working in a volunteer capacity for a volunteer fire department or ambulance company is covered; and

(2) volunteer working for a hazardous materials response team may be covered;

by the medical treatment and burial expense provisions of the worker's compensation law (IC 22-3-2 through IC 22-3-6) and the worker's occupational diseases law (IC 22-3-7).

(b) Subject to section 10.3 of this chapter, if compensability of the injury is an issue, the administrative procedures of IC 22-3-2 through IC 22-3-6 and IC 22-3-7 shall be used to determine the issue.

(c) This subsection applies to all units, including counties. All expenses incurred for premiums of the insurance allowed under this section may be paid from the unit's general fund in the same manner as other expenses in the unit are paid.

[Pre-Local Government Recodification Citation: 19-1-40-1 part.]

As added by Acts 1981, P.L.309, SEC.64. Amended by P.L.198-1988, SEC.1; P.L.3-1989, SEC.230; P.L.172-1990, SEC.2; P.L.72-1992, SEC.5; P.L.1-1999, SEC.95; P.L.174-2009, SEC.6; P.L.167-2019, SEC.3.
